Variant summary

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_182833.3(GDPD4):​c.1120G>C​(p.Val374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000682 in 1,613,502 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. V374I) has been classified as Uncertain significance.

Genes affected
GDPD4 (HGNC:24849): (glycerophosphodiester phosphodiesterase domain containing 4) Predicted to enable metal ion binding activity and phosphoric diester hydrolase activity. Predicted to be involved in lipid metabolic process. Predicted to be integral component of membrane. [provided by Alliance of Genome Resources, Apr 2022]
